Output ed34a32fd343d2dc892ff027b71cdda9bf07a8b7a59bb5ab0b78c5d27dc53dde: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6156038df214d972618d25b57659622bd6886601 OP_EQUAL
address
3AZgWVzta5CuqBVLRhQLmoLhhmvcN87B1G
transaction
ed34a32fd343d2dc892ff027b71cdda9bf07a8b7a59bb5ab0b78c5d27dc53dde
confirmations
142372
spent
true